What happens when we finally get our needs met?
We scramble after money, love, accolades, power, etc., yet study after study shows that once basic needs are met, additional pursuit does not enhance happiness.
Will Smith talks about the concept of “cliff top” (opposite of "rock bottom”) where a person has achieved everything they wanted in the material world—money, fame, sex, and success— and still finds themselves missing lasting happiness.
He says reaching the cliff top can lead to an "abyss" where life loses its ability to sustain and please, and the only way out is to find what one is truly looking for; oneself.
Today Stephanie and Maren explore cliff top and rock bottom and discuss several powerful questions including,
- Can you find yourself without falling off the cliff and hitting rock bottom first?
- Are those the only two paths to waking up and getting to lasting happiness?
- How do you get started?
Their great discussion peels the curtain back around societal conditioning and unconscious beliefs. More importantly, it opens a path that is both friendly and freeing.
